How To Become A Life Coach

By Sean Mennell


If you are the type of person that gets pleasure out of helping others deal with their situations in life then you may be wondering how you can use your interests in a positive manner. Tips on how to become a life coach might be just the answer you need to get pointed in the direction of a career that is very satisfying. The first thing you will want to do is get the proper education and certification.

The idea of a career such as this has been making leaps and bounds over the years as the public have become more and more aware of their need to create goals for themselves and to meet those goals. Educators and those in the field of psychology often take the opportunity to understand their students or clientele by furthering their education in this manner.

Finding a program that will meet your needs begins by searching the various options out there. While you are likely to find a listing in your local phone book, probably the easiest way to find what you are looking for and then narrow down your search quickly is to simply do an Internet search.

Once you have decided upon which courses you would like to pursue simply contact the program and ask them to forward you an information packet. In some cases you may find that you can have the information forwarded simply by filling out forms on the Internet.

A helpful option is available to many is to speak to somebody who is already certified. If they are willing to take the time to talk to you then it is likely you will find a lot of useful information. You may even want to think about asking them to offer their opinion as to which courses they have found the most helpful in the pursuit of their career.

There are actually quite a few different choices to consider within the career itself. Often people think of a job like this simply somebody who offers advice on a particular topic when in fact, there are a number of specialties one can go into. For example, many choose to specialize in relationship, money management or management and leadership skills.

To get yourself started it is a good idea if you can find a local seminar which is offering a lecture. By attending you will get a sense of what it is like to be leading a group and what kind of energy is needed for the meeting to succeed. This opportunity will also give you an idea of what kind of people are drawn to those who helped in this manner.
